Q: Hi, I'd like to measure UCP2 levels in various mouse tissues by western blot. I was wondering which of your antibodies would be best for this purpose. In the literature I have seen some papers where they have isolated mitochondria to be able to see UCP2 and others where they have not. We would like to use frozen tissue samples, so isolating mitochondria will not be an option. We would like to use liver, muscle, pancreas, kidney, brown fat, subcutaneous fat, and gonadal fat. I'd appreciate any advice you might have.
A: Regarding your question on our UCP2 antibodies, we do have a product (catalog # NB100-78377), but our lab confirmed that it has only been validated in mouse liver and brain and there is no guarantee on other tissues.
